Why asphalt can flow under a parked truck

HERE’S THE INTERESTING PART

That solid black road you drive on isn't truly solid. Asphalt is a highly viscous non-Newtonian material. While it feels like rock to a fast-moving car, if you leave a heavy parked truck on it during a hot day, the material will casually flow away from the tires, leaving permanent ruts.
